## GPU memory profiling for plugin authors

Vexalite exposes a profiling hook so your plugin can report allocation snapshots per frame. Enable it with the `--mem-trace` flag in the sandbox runner; output lands in the standard trace directory. Budget overruns get your plugin throttled, not killed. Allocation limits, sampling rates, and trace format docs are published here.

dashboard of bafof-hafog = https://confluence.lumiclabs.internal/display/browse/display/6a09a20a

Ticket: DEDUP-412 — Connection failures during customer record dedup

The Larkspur dedup job started failing overnight with pool exhaustion errors. It merges duplicate customer records in batches of 500, but the batch worker isn't releasing connections after a merge conflict, so the pool drains within twenty minutes. Proposed fix: wrap merges in a try/finally release and cap retries at three. For the sync, reproduce against staging using the connection string below.

primary connection of bagep-kaweg = clickhouse://rusdor_svc:3TXlgH7O8DuUYI@db-ae3f.zarqelgrid.internal:5432/zordor

When your plugin hooks into the Givewell-Grove donation-receipt mailer, always register a template validator before enabling sends; unvalidated templates are silently dropped by the Heron queue, and donors receive nothing. Test against the sandbox ledger first, and confirm the receipt hash appears in your plugin logs. Full hook signatures and sandbox setup are documented on the internal page here:

wiki page, tahaf-tajog: https://jira.ordindyn.corp/pipeline

UserSplit Cutover Drift: the extracted account service and the legacy Marigold monolith user module are reporting divergent record counts during dual-write. This fires when drift exceeds 0.5% over 15 minutes. New team members should not replay writes manually. Reconciliation steps and the rollback procedure are documented on the internal page.

wiki page, tajog-fafog: https://gitlab.paliqsys.corp/dash/display/job/853dd6fcbf54

// REINDEX_BATCH_CAP limits docs per shard pass in the Tallowfield
// nightly search reindex. Raising it starves the ingest queue;
// lowering it overruns the maintenance window. 5000 is the tested
// sweet spot. Change only with a soak run. Verified against the
// build noted below.

session token of bawif-hahog = htk6_ac5981